🗂️ Amazon’s Hierarchical Product Structure

Amazon classifies products using a multi-tiered system made up of:

Main Departments (top-level categories)

Subcategories (nested under departments)

Browse Nodes (specific category ID numbers)

Product Attributes (size, color, brand, etc.)


📌 Example: Classification for a Laptop

Level Classification

Department Electronics

Subcategory Computers & Accessories

Sub-subcategory Laptops

Product Type Traditional Laptop

Attributes 16GB RAM, Intel i7, 512GB SSD, Brand: Dell

⚠️ Restricted & Special Product Categories

Some product categories require Amazon’s approval due to safety or legal concerns.


✅ Gated Categories (require approval):

Fine Art

Collectible Coins

Jewelry

Automotive & Powersports

Personal Safety & Household Products


🔥 Hazardous Materials:

Products with lithium batteries

Aerosols

Industrial chemicals


🧰 Tools for Sellers: Amazon Product Classifier

The Amazon Product Classifier Tool helps sellers:

Choose the most accurate category

Avoid listing errors

Get their products live faster


🧭 How It Works:

Enter product keywords

Answer Amazon’s classification questions

Get suggested category/browse node

🔗 Tip: Sellers can access it via Seller Central → Inventory → Add a Product


🌍 Regional Differences in Classification

Each Amazon marketplace (e.g., US, UK, India) may use slightly different category names or structures based on:

Consumer behavior

Local regulations

Currency & measurement units


Example:

A “cell phone” in the US is classified as "Mobile Phone" in the UK

Power voltage compatibility differs for electronics between regions

✅ Best Practices for Sellers

To list products correctly and increase visibility:

✔️ Choose the most specific subcategory possible

✔️ Fill in every relevant attribute (size, color, weight, etc.)

✔️ Regularly review your listings for compliance

✔️ Study competitors’ listings in your niche

✔️ Avoid misclassification, which can lead to listing removal

🧠 Pro Tip: Use backend keywords in Seller Central to help your product show up in related searches (even if not in the title)
